The winners of the 2010 Barry Awards were announced last night at Bouchercon. This annual award is presented by the editorial staff of Deadly Pleasures for the best works published in the field of crime fiction.
◊ Best Novel: The Last Child by John Hart (Minotaur Books)
◊ Best First Novel: The Sweetness at the Bottom of the Pie by Alan Bradley (Delacorte)
◊ Best British Novel: If The Dead Not Rise by Philip Kerr (Quercus)
◊ Best Paperback Original: Starvation Lake by Bryan Gruley (Touchstone)
◊ Best Thriller: Running from the Devil by Jamie Freveletti (Wm. Morrow)
◊ Best Mystery/Crime Novel of the Decade: The Girl with the Dragon Tattoo by Stieg Larsson (Knopf)
◊ Best Short Story: "The High House Writer" by Brendan DuBois (Alfred Hitchcock Mystery Magazine)
